Extreme Surfer Birthday Card


This card started out as last week's Mojo Monday sketch challenge and then changed a bit. I used the Extreme Surfer Stamp, Teeny Weeny Wishes (for the greeting), Brocade Blue, Night of Navy, & Whisper White Card Stock, Night of Navy & White Ink, and a stamping sponge. I used my Nestabilities to make the circles. I tore the card stock, sponged on white ink, and layered it to make the waves.

Father's Day Card


This is one of the Father's Day cards that we made at a stamp camp. The set is And many Mower (from the mini catalog) I also used Manchester Designer Paper, Chocolate Chip, Blush Blossom, Going Grey, Always Artichoke, Baja Breeze, & Creamy Caramel Inks and/or Card Stock. I used the Swiss Dots Cuttlebug Folder for the golf ball and put it dent side up so the it looked like the dents of a golf ball. Click on the image to get a closer look.
